Output c4da71d8754c0c21952683dfd97ac3e83e44e57bb3a39b0eef72aa2edca61b8d:0

value
9600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f696c52628b34e8d1b5ad82d99702dd635db683 OP_EQUAL
address
3APWQhHAPRJxyLfDyCXo6k2QA1EBCYEeL7
transaction
c4da71d8754c0c21952683dfd97ac3e83e44e57bb3a39b0eef72aa2edca61b8d
confirmations
308552
spent
true